About the Delivery Project Director Role

Qiddiya Investment Company is seeking a highly skilled and experienced Delivery Project Director (DEL 1) to oversee the successful delivery of critical projects in Riyadh, Saudi Arabia. This pivotal role is responsible for ensuring projects align with the company's strategic objectives and uphold operational excellence. The Project Director will set the overall project direction, ensuring timely and cost-effective completion, and will be accountable for all project disciplines, compliance, and safety standards. This position requires a seasoned professional with a proven track record in managing large-scale, complex programs within demanding environments.

Key Responsibilities

  • Lead and foster a strong health, safety, and wellbeing culture throughout the project, including conducting safety investigations, inspections, and audits.
  • Role model leadership behaviors in line with Qiddiya Values.
  • Motivate and inspire a high-performance culture through clear direction, continuous feedback, recognition of exceptional performance, and fostering an environment of collaboration, innovation, and accountability.
  • Provide visible, inclusive leadership, ensuring effective succession planning, exploring recruitment and retention strategies, and offering mentoring and sponsorship to staff.
  • Lead collaboration and manage interfaces across design, procurement, construction, testing, and commissioning activities to deliver completed assets in accordance with approved designs, cost plans, and milestone dates.
  • Work closely with other directors and the senior management team to maximize project efficiencies across all project facets, including integration, interfaces, and interdependencies with the wider program to enable seamless construction phasing.
  • Prepare and present project status and updates to Qiddiya Control committees and relevant groups.
  • Lead project review processes to ensure effective progress reporting and maintain in-depth knowledge of all project elements.
  • Work effectively with commercial, contracts, and cost teams to facilitate successful project delivery while managing project budgets and financials.
  • Identify, manage, and mitigate delivery risk exposure to the project by ensuring adequate controls are identified and applied.
  • Leverage opportunities within peer groups for collaboration, sharing lessons learned, and driving innovation.
